Angiùla

Romagnol

Etymology

From Latin Angela (Angela), from Ancient Greek ἄγγελος (ángelos, messeger, angel).

Pronunciation

  • (Central Romagnol): IPA(key): [ɐnˈd͡ʒuːlɐ]

Proper noun

Angiùla f (plural Angiùl)

  1. a female given name from Latin
